The fourth-generation Opel Corsa has changed little from its predecessor - the car has become similar to the somewhat earlier sympathetic Opel Adam, although the company has retained the doors and glass in the same design as the pimta to save on development costs. Inside, there are more changes - a new panel design with a touch screen, body-colored plastic inserts give life. Another innovation is the 1.0-liter three-cylinder turbo engine generating a pretty decent 113 hp. On the road, the new Corsa has become more stable, with excellent maneuverability in the city, but the suspension absorbs bumps well, better than the nearest competitor Ford Fiesta.
